Our Defensible Space Process

Systematic approach to creating fire-safe zones around your property.

1

Property Assessment

We evaluate your property against CAL FIRE defensible space requirements, identifying vegetation risks and compliance gaps.

2

Zone Planning

We create a detailed plan for Zone 1 (0-30 feet) and Zone 2 (30-100 feet) defensible space around your structures.

3

Clearance Work

Our crew removes dry brush, dead vegetation, ladder fuels, and thins trees to create proper spacing and reduce fire risk.

4

Documentation

We provide photos and documentation of completed work for CAL FIRE compliance, insurance requirements, and HOA records.

Fire Hazard Clearance FAQs

Common questions about our fire hazard clearance services.

What is defensible space?

Defensible space is the buffer between your home and the surrounding vegetation that reduces fire risk. California law requires 100 feet of defensible space in wildfire-prone areas. We create and maintain compliant defensible space.

Do your services meet CAL FIRE requirements?

Yes. Our fire hazard clearance work is designed to meet CAL FIRE and local fire department requirements. We understand the 100-foot defensible space zones and ensure your property meets compliance standards.

Can you help with insurance requirements?

Yes. Many insurance companies require proof of defensible space maintenance. We provide documentation and photos of completed work to satisfy insurance requirements.

How often should defensible space be maintained?

CAL FIRE recommends annual defensible space maintenance. Vegetation grows back, especially in spring. Annual clearance keeps your property compliant and protected year-round.
